Amuse is a seasonal, farm to table driven restaurant, located on the third floor of the museum. Whether you are dining in our main dining room, full-service bar, or our private dining room, you will be able to take in sweeping views of the Robins Sculpture Garden and the museum’s Cochrane Atrium. Our team works diligently to provide a menu that is directly inspired by the art-filled surroundings, current exhibitions, and seasonality while also carefully selecting only the finest ingredients from local vendors, artisans, and farmers. Just a friendly reminder that the museum does not allow balloons, confetti, glitter, plants potted with soil, and candles with open flames.     While we originally had planned to reserve a table at Floris (the other restaurant on the property) and were a little saddened not to be going to tea service, this luncheon was the absolute best mistake I’ve ever made. The hostess even called the other restaurant for us to see if we could get a table. When we couldn’t, however, we leaned into the experience. The menu, inspired by Kahlo’s art, was a fine blend of VA southern and Mexican. We started with the Love Embrace cocktail, a spicy, flowery vodka drink that looked as good as it tasted. From there, we tried the spoon bread and roasted beet appetizers. Both were flavorful and eye catching. Entrees of scallops and chorizo with ramps were both pleasing to both palate and eyes. The chorizo dish, while appearing unassuming in the menu, was one of the best meals I’ve had in Richmond. Our server, Max, was attentive and well versed on the menu and the museum. Highly recommend visiting this lovely spot for lunch or dinner.
